These assemblies typically include a catch, spring, and release button or lever, each engineered for seamless interaction with your firearm’s magazine well. Materials range from rugged steel to lightweight alloys, offering options tailored to different needs—some prioritize enhanced durability for rigorous use, while others focus on ergonomics, such as extended or textured release buttons for improved grip and faster access. Maintenance and customization are ongoing aspects of responsible firearm ownership. Over time, springs can lose tension, or release buttons can become worn, especially with regular use or frequent magazine changes. Swapping in a new or upgraded assembly is a straightforward way to restore crisp, reliable magazine retention and ejection.
